EU agricultural sector is faced with critical issues: enormous costs of protecting crops against diseases and pests, permanent pesticide pollution of soil and groundwater, toxic residues in fruit sold for direct consumption, toxicological risks for people working in orchards. In commercial orchards it is a common practice to perform 20-25 phytosanitary sprays every season only against fungal pathogens. Each year this translates into a heavy environmental burden, with over 200-250 kg of toxic chemicals per hectare and heavy economic burden for producers, starting at approx. 1550 EUR per hectare. In face of these challenges, there is a growing demand for advisory platforms and decision support systems (DSS) to aid producers in regard to chemical protection of crops.
CITRUS-PORT is a disruptive innovation project for crop protection sector - digital tool for citrus growers that calculates and signals the right time to apply treatments to protect orchards against pests and diseases. It has potential to become the first global digital advisory platform for citrus fruit segment, as market is currently missing any comprehensive solution for this crop. It will provide citrus growers with personalized advice on when and how to treat their orchards against diseases and pests, in order to increase efficiency and decrease pesticide use by cca. 30-40%.
Enabling our customers to conserve resources, while minimizing negative environmental consequences, significantly contributes to sustainability. Decrease in pesticide use goes hand in hand with lower toxicological and health risks for farmers as well as public. The quality of produced fruits increases, as the toxic chemical residues are reduced by cca. 60%, contributing to safety of food we all consume.
